Safety Instructions
Observe this documentation, in particular all
included safety information, in order to pro-
tect yourself and others from injury, and to
prevent damage to the device.
• Carefully and completely read and
adhere to these operating instructions,
as well as the documentation for the
respective measuring instrument.
The respective documents can be found
at http://www.gossenmetrawatt.com.
Retain these documents for future refer-
ence.
• Tests may only be performed by a quali-
fied electrician, or under the supervision
and direction of a qualified electrician.
The user must be instructed by a quali-
fied electrician concerning performance
and evaluation of the test.
• Wear suitable and appropriate personal
protective equipment (PPE) whenever
working with the device.
• If the device doesn’t function flawlessly,
remove it from operation and secure it
against inadvertent use.
• The device may only be used as long as
it’s in good working order.
Inspect the device before use. Pay par-
ticular attention to damaged housings,
broken insulation around the sockets
and kinked cables.
• Use the device only in measuring cate-
gory O.
(It may not be used in measuring catego-
ries II, III or IV.)
Inter-turn short circuit measurements
may thus only be conducted at voltage-
free coils.
• Do not use the device in potentially
explosive atmospheres.
• The device must not be exposed to
direct sunlight.
• Do not use the device after long periods
of storage under unfavorable conditions
(e.g. humidity, dust or extreme tempera-
ture).
• Do not use the device after extraordinary
stressing due to transport.
• If the device is damaged during use, for
example if it’s dropped, remove it from
operation permanently and secure it
against inadvertent use.
• The device is a measuring accessory in
accordance with IEC 61010–031 /
DIN EN 61010–031 / VDE 0411–031
and may only be used for this purpose.
• Only inductances/coils may be con-
nected to the device’s measuring sock-
ets.
• Beware of dangerous voltage at
exposed motor connections!
Always connect all three motor connec-
tions to the device at the same time
when conducting measurements at 3-
phase motors.
• Beware of dangerous voltage at trans-
formers!
Depending on the transformation ratio,
high voltages may occur at the output
side of the transformer during inter-turn
short circuit measurements.
• Never touch the conductive ends of the
test probes.
• Perform measurements with the help of
self-retaining contacts (e.g. alligator
clips).
Danger of fatal injury exists if the con-
tacting elements slip off!
Poor contact may result in sparking.
• Never activate the rotary switch or the
rocker switch during a measurement –
danger of injury! The device may also be
damaged or destroyed.
